Molecular systems subsystem resolution

The theory of molecular interactions, and the theory of chemical reactivity in particular, deal with reactive systems consisting of complementary subsystems. One of major goals of the quantum chemistry is to determine various effects of their interaction, both intra- and inter-subsystem in cheu acter, emd how they influence the ultimate reactivity trends.
